It was bred on Vancouver Island and over the years became both stabilized and locally acclimated. It's a true IBL, meaning that if you buy a packet of seeds, you can reproduce them with a simple cross- all offspring will be uniform, and you can keep yourself supplied with beans indefinitely. It's very mold-resistant because the buds aren't super dense and they dry quickly after a rain.

Yes, it is a Sativa dominant strain. Full Sativas are not medically available in my area that I'm aware of, probably because they get very tall and bushy and are difficult to grow indoors.

The effects leave one clear-headed and energized, with a very nice buzz. It is a good anxiety/tension reliever and won't make you paranoid like some of the more knockout indicas. It also works well as a muscle relaxant, and gives a pleasant calming effect that can be felt in the body as well as promoting a positive mental state.

There is no "burn-out" afterwards where you feel drained or get a headache or anything, like in some of the stronger indicas, and it won't make you sluggish. It's good for the mornings and throughout the day. It's good for relieving headaches because of its smooth, clear-headed effect.
